Directed by John Avildson
Screenplay by Sylvester Stallone
Starring: Sylvester Stallone; Talia Shire; Burt Young; Carl Weathers; and Burgess Meredeth

You know the story so let me give you some fun facts:
-Butkus the dog was actually Stallone's dog
-The famous run through the streets of Philly was shot guerrilla-style for they did not have the money to get permits. So they would jump in and out of vans to take shots.
-The fighting or boxing part of the film was influenced by the Chuck Wepner and Muhammad Ali fight.
-During Weathers tryout for Clay he accidentally hit Stallone on the chin. Weathers then said if he could have an actual actor instead of a stand-in he would do better. He then learned Stallone was the actual actor. In which Weathers said..."Well..maybe he will get better as filming moves on."
-This was the highest grossing film in 1976. Made for 960,000. It grossed 5 million in its opening weekend. Total for its run was 117 million dollars.
-This film was shot in 28 days
-Talia Shire jumped at the chance to play Adrian. Even for the mere 7500 dollars she was payed. She was hoping to get out from under the shadows of her big brother Francis Ford Coppola.

The film touches people in different ways or for different reasons. There is a reason the 72 steps at the Philadelphia Art Museum are called the Rocky Steps. It is estimated that about 100,000 people run the steps each year....maybe more.
